Комментарии 2
Ответ: инструмент поддерживает жесты через класс
TouchAction
. Например, для жестов свайпа используются методыpress
,moveTo
иrelease
.
Стираем. Это убрали больше года назад.
приложение и пакет приложения (
appPackage
),
Уж если указываете Андроидовский appPackage
, то надо бы указать и bundleId
от iOS
Ответ: для распознавания элементов мобильных приложений Appium применяет локаторы, аналогичные Selenium. Это могут быть
id
,name
,class
,XPath
. А также в Appium используются локаторыaccessibility id
.
Тут забыты нативные локаторы Android: UiSelector, UiSelector, iOS: NSPredicate, Class Chain Queries.
0
Было бы не плохо еще добавить вопрос, про какой локатор лучше использовать и почему и расставить их в порядке приоритета использования.
0
Зарегистрируйтесь на Хабре, чтобы оставить комментарий
Вопросы по Appium на собеседовании